1977 Chevrolet G20 Beauville, Classic Luxury VanThis 1977 Chevrolet G20 Van is a beautifully preserved example of classic 1970s American van culture. The Beauville trim represented the most luxurious and well-appointed configuration available, combining comfort, utility, and premium materials that made it stand apart from the standard G-series lineup.Finished in its mostly original paint with only a few light touch-ups, this G20 retains its authentic look and vintage charm. The original interior remains in excellent condition, showcasing how carefully this van has been maintained throughout its life.Under the hood, it's been thoughtfully refreshed for reliability and performance. Power comes from a newer 350 cubic-inch Chevrolet crate V8 engine, paired with a rebuilt JEGS automatic transmission. The carburetor has been rebuilt, and the brakes, suspension, and tires are all new. The result is a van that drives incredibly smooth, the 350 runs like a dream, offering effortless power and confidence on the road.Comfort and convenience are second to none for the era, with front and factory rear air conditioning, power steering, and power disc brakes, making this Beauville a comfortable cruiser ready for long trips or weekend drives.Whether you're a collector of original survivors or searching for a well-sorted vintage van that blends character, comfort, and drivability, this Beauville delivers a rare combination of originality, quality, and craftsmanship, a standout piece of Chevrolet history.
